NSA Codebreaker Challenge 2022
The NSA Codebreaker Challenge provides students with a hands-on opportunity to develop their reverse-engineering / low-level code analysis skills while working on a realistic problem set centered around the NSA's mission. Jackson State Community College has participated in the Codebreaker Challenge for the last 3 years. Each year Jackson State’s student participation has continually increased.
NICE Challenge Project @ Jackson State Community College
We bring students the workforce experience before the workforce.
The NICE Challenge Project developes real-world cybersecurity challenges within virtualized business environments that bring students the workforce experience before the workforce. Our goal is to provide the most realistic experience to students at-scale year-round, while also generating useful assessment data about their knowledge, skills, and abilities.
SkillsUSA
Jackson State Community College’s Cyber Defense majors participate in SkillsUSA competitions with other schools in the state. The last competition was held in Bell Buckle, Tennessee. The students are given several challenges with solutions being judge by industry experts. Competition content is based on NICE framework.
